u/HoneydewNo9640

I’m currently trying to build a robot dog with Arduino Uno. It’s my first robotics project, but I’ve run into issues with the servo driver. I have 10 MSg90 servos connected to the driver but have been moving them one at a time so far.

When I try to move one of the legs, the servo connected to it shakes violently until I hold it steady to stop it. The servos were working for about a day, but when I tried again today, only the first programmed movements worked. After that, they stopped responding completely.

I had to switch to a new servo driver to get them working again, but the legs were still shaking. After testing, I think it may be a power issue. I’m not sure if it’s too much power or too little. I know servo shaking can happen from low power, but I also think too much power may have damaged the first driver.

My current setup: • Servo driver power port connected to a 6V 2000mAh Ni-CD battery • From the driver pins, I have GND, 5V, and analog pins connected

I also tried using a 5V 5A DC adapter, but nothing happened when using that. I don’t think the issue is wiring, so I’m not sure what to do next. Any ideas?

reddit.com
u/HoneydewNo9640 — 26 days ago